Taxonomic Classification

Rank Alder Maple Mildew
Kingdom Plantae (Plants) Fungi (Fungi)
Phylum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) Ascomycota (Sac Fungi)
Class Magnoliopsida (Dicots) Leotiomycetes (Leotiomycetes)
Order Fagales (Beeches & Oaks) Helotiales (Helotiales)
Family Betulaceae Erysiphaceae
Genus Alnus Sawadaea
Species Alnus acuminata Sawadaea bicornis
